1110051050054 has 8 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 1668835214280. Its totient is φ = 553772645296.
The previous prime is 1110051050041. The next prime is 1110051050117. The reversal of 1110051050054 is 4500501500111.
It is a sphenic number, since it is the product of 3 distinct primes.
It is a Curzon number.
It is a congruent number.
It is an unprimeable number.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 3 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 626438759 + ... + 626440530.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(208604401785).
Almost surely, 21110051050054 is an apocalyptic number.
1110051050054 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(558784164226).
1110051050054 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
1110051050054 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The sum of its prime factors is 1252879734.
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 500, while the sum is 23.
Adding to 1110051050054 its reverse (4500501500111), we get a palindrome (5610552550165).
The spelling of 1110051050054 in words is "one trillion, one hundred ten billion, fifty-one million, fifty thousand, fifty-four".
